About Telehouse
Global Carrier-Neutral Data Centers
Telehouse is a worldwide carrier-neutral data center and colocation provider operated by KDDI Group (Japan’s second-largest telecommunications company). With 45+ data centers across 25 countries and densely populated carrier ecosystems (especially Telehouse London Docklands, one of the largest internet exchange points in Europe), Telehouse provides colocation, interconnection, cross-connects, and multi-cloud connectivity tailored to global enterprises and service providers needing carrier choice and low-latency peering.

Recognition & proof points
- Telehouse London Docklands is positioned as Europe's most carrier-dense data centre campus and the original home of LINX. Company-stated milestones: first purpose-built colocation facility in Europe to gain ISO 14001
- Telehouse Paris (Voltaire) awarded France's Security Award
- first foreign data centre provider recognized in China for 'Best 3rd Party Infrastructure Provider.'
